news 2026/5/21 9:10:36

5大核心优势:让图表创作效率提升80%的开源编辑器深度测评

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
5大核心优势:让图表创作效率提升80%的开源编辑器深度测评

5大核心优势:让图表创作效率提升80%的开源编辑器深度测评

【免费下载链接】mermaid-live-editorEdit, preview and share mermaid charts/diagrams. New implementation of the live editor.项目地址: https://gitcode.com/GitHub_Trending/me/mermaid-live-editor

重新定义图表创作:从工具到生产力革命

当产品经理还在为流程图的箭头位置反复调整时,开发团队已经用Mermaid语法完成了整套系统架构图;当设计师为甘特图的配色方案纠结时,项目管理者早已通过代码生成了自动更新的进度可视化。这种效率差距的背后,是Mermaid Live Editor带来的创作范式转变。作为一款开源的实时图表编辑工具,它将文本编程与视觉创作完美融合,让复杂图表的绘制时间从小时级压缩到分钟级。

破解三大行业痛点:垂直场景的深度应用

医疗行业:手术流程标准化的可视化方案

某三甲医院麻醉科将复杂的麻醉流程转化为Mermaid时序图,通过文本定义标准化操作步骤,新入职医生培训周期缩短40%。通过版本控制功能,可追踪不同时期的流程优化记录,实现医疗质量的持续改进。

金融领域:合规审计的可追溯图表系统

投资银行使用该工具生成监管要求的交易流程图,所有修改都留有文本记录,满足SEC审计的可追溯性要求。在一次重大合规检查中,团队通过比对不同版本的图表文件,快速定位了流程漏洞,避免了潜在的监管风险。

制造业:产线优化的协作可视化平台

汽车工厂将生产线布局转化为Mermaid流程图,工程师可直接通过代码调整工作站位置,系统自动渲染3D布局预览。这种方式使产线调整方案的沟通效率提升60%,错误率降低75%。

竞品对决:为什么Mermaid Live Editor能脱颖而出

特性Mermaid Live Editor传统绘图工具其他代码绘图工具
实时预览✅ 毫秒级响应❌ 需手动刷新⚠️ 延迟>1秒
版本控制✅ 原生支持Git❌ 需第三方工具⚠️ 需额外配置
协作编辑✅ 生成协作链接❌ 不支持⚠️ 需付费订阅
离线使用✅ PWA支持⚠️ 部分功能受限❌ 完全依赖网络
学习曲线⭐⭐⭐ 中等⭐ 简单⭐⭐⭐⭐ 陡峭

核心优势在于其"文本即图表"的核心理念,将可视化创作转化为结构化文本编辑,既保留了代码的精确性和可维护性,又通过实时渲染消除了纯代码工具的使用门槛。

技术架构解密:看似简单背后的工程智慧

前端渲染引擎的性能优化

编辑器采用双线程架构,将Mermaid语法解析与SVG渲染分离到Web Worker中执行,确保复杂图表渲染时界面仍保持60fps流畅操作。通过虚拟DOM diff算法,只更新图表变化部分,比全量重绘减少85%的计算资源消耗。

Monaco编辑器的深度定制

在VS Code同款编辑器基础上,开发团队实现了Mermaid语法的智能提示系统,通过分析上下文提供精准的图表元素建议。例如输入"graph TD"后,自动提示常用节点定义格式,将语法错误率降低60%。

状态管理的创新实现

采用Svelte的响应式系统结合自定义状态机,实现了编辑历史的高效管理。每个操作都被转化为不可变状态快照,支持无限撤销/重做,同时保持内存占用低于100MB。

从零到一:高效图表创作实践指南

环境搭建:3分钟启动开发之旅

# 获取项目代码 git clone https://gitcode.com/GitHub_Trending/me/mermaid-live-editor # 安装依赖 pnpm install # 启动本地服务 pnpm dev -- --open

完成以上步骤后,系统会自动打开浏览器,展示编辑器界面。无需复杂配置,即可开始图表创作。

核心操作:掌握5个提效技巧

  1. 片段复用:将常用图表结构保存为代码片段,通过Ctrl+Shift+P快速插入
  2. 样式批量调整:使用classDef定义样式类,一键统一修改同类节点外观
  3. 版本对比:通过历史记录功能比较不同版本的图表变化,追踪修改轨迹
  4. 导出策略:优先选择SVG格式保证矢量质量,需要图片时再转为PNG
  5. 协作技巧:创建编辑链接时设置权限级别,控制协作者的修改范围

高级应用:自定义主题开发

通过修改src/lib/util/mermaid.ts中的主题配置,可创建符合企业品牌的自定义图表风格。系统支持从CSS文件导入样式变量,实现图表与公司网站的视觉统一。

未来演进:从工具到生态的跨越

Mermaid Live Editor团队计划在未来版本中引入AI辅助创作功能,通过自然语言描述自动生成图表代码。同时正在开发的插件系统将允许第三方开发者扩展图表类型,预计2024年将支持3D流程图渲染。随着WebAssembly技术的成熟,未来甚至可能在浏览器中实现图表的实时协作编辑,彻底改变团队协作的方式。

这款开源工具证明,优秀的技术不是增加复杂度,而是用智慧消除障碍。当图表创作从"点击拖拽"回归到"逻辑表达"的本质,我们获得的不仅是效率提升,更是思维方式的革新。无论你是技术文档撰写者、项目管理者还是教育工作者,都能在这个文本与视觉的交汇点上,发现创作的新可能。

【免费下载链接】mermaid-live-editorEdit, preview and share mermaid charts/diagrams. New implementation of the live editor.项目地址: https://gitcode.com/GitHub_Trending/me/mermaid-live-editor

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/1 21:16:38

AI Coding 进阶指南:Trae AI插件在Pycharm中的高效配置与实战技巧

1. 为什么开发者需要Trae AI插件 如果你经常使用PyCharm进行Python开发,一定会遇到这样的场景:写一个复杂函数时突然卡壳,或者调试一段老代码时死活找不到问题所在。这时候Trae AI插件就像个随时待命的编程搭档,能帮你快速解决这些…

作者头像 李华
网站建设 2026/4/5 7:24:54

[AI/应用/MCP] MCP Server/Tool 开发指南

1. 智能软件工程的范式转移:从库集成到原生框架演进 在生成式人工智能(Generative AI)从单纯的文本生成向具备自主规划与执行能力的“代理化(Agentic)”系统跨越的过程中,.NET 生态系统正在经历一场自该平台…

作者头像 李华
网站建设 2026/4/5 21:24:06

Vue + G 实战:打造高校学生打卡数据可视化大屏

一、各自优势和对比 这是检索出来的数据,据说是根据第三方评测与企业数据,三款产品在代码生成质量上各有侧重: 产品 语言优势 场景亮点 核心差异 百度 Comate C核心代码质量第一;Python首生成率达92.3% SQL生成准确率提升35%&…

作者头像 李华
网站建设 2026/4/7 6:45:22

暗黑破坏神2存档修改实用教程:从入门到精通的d2s编辑器全攻略

暗黑破坏神2存档修改实用教程:从入门到精通的d2s编辑器全攻略 【免费下载链接】d2s-editor 项目地址: https://gitcode.com/gh_mirrors/d2/d2s-editor d2s-editor是一款专为《暗黑破坏神2》玩家打造的开源存档编辑工具,支持角色属性调整、物品管…

作者头像 李华
网站建设 2026/4/1 21:01:28

ViGEmBus虚拟手柄驱动全面指南:从核心价值到深度应用

ViGEmBus虚拟手柄驱动全面指南:从核心价值到深度应用 【免费下载链接】ViGEmBus Windows kernel-mode driver emulating well-known USB game controllers. 项目地址: https://gitcode.com/gh_mirrors/vi/ViGEmBus 一、突破输入局限:ViGEmBus内核…

作者头像 李华